## Summary
The Motorola RAZR i is a smartphone designed by Motorola Mobility, running on the Android operating system. It is part of the Droid Razr series and features a sleek design with dimensions of 60.9 mm (width), 122.5 mm (height), and 8.3 mm (thickness), weighing 126 grams. The device supports microSD card storage and is powered by a lithium-ion battery.
